Briefly, the SI value is a measure of the degree of change in expression of a feature (e.g. an exon) between two conditions relative to the change in expression at the gene level. The RI value is a measure of the degree to which the change of the feature is reciprocal in direction to that observed for the gene overall. For example, if an exon is up-regulated but the gene overall is down-regulated, this will give a higher RI value. The PFC value is a measure of the degree of differential expression of the feature compared to the entire gene. For example, if a gene is not changed overall between two conditions, but the feature is highly differentially expressed, this will give a higher PFC value. For exon junction features the number of exons skipped by the junction is indicated as 'Sn' where n is the number of exons skipped (e.g. S0 means no exons skipped, S1 means one exon skipped, etc.).
